AFAIK it's Samsung only (C and above) and requires additional non-standard implementation. They basically split a video into 5 chunks, generate a thumbnail for it (CPU load?) and then present this metadata to the TV in a specific manner.

After googling it seems that m2ts container is not the solution for chapter.

But I read that with DLNA MPEG_PS_NTSC and MPEG_PS_PAL profile, the server could provide IFO file in resources. And I know that IFO file implements PCR timestamp information but also chapter informations.
Zip, do you have informations about IFO file support?



EDIT: In fact it seems that server could detect a DVD structure folder then provide stream files (VTS_xxxx) and IFO file in <res>

For example a Twonky example :
  Code:
object.container:
    <container id="0$3$32$46$47" parentID="0$3$32$46" restricted="1" childCount="9" searchable="1">
    <dc:title>09</dc:title>
    <upnp:genre>Unknown</upnp:genre>
    <pv:modificationTime>1316588594</pv:modificationTime>
    <upnp:class>object.container</upnp:class>
    </container>

object.item.videoItem.movie:
    <item id="0$3$32$46$47R2315" refID="0$3$28I2315" parentID="0$3$32$46$47" restricted="1">
    <dc:title>VTS_01_0</dc:title>
    <dc:date>2011-09-20</dc:date>
    <upnp:genre>Unknown</upnp:genre>
    <upnp:album>VIDEO_TS</upnp:album>
    <upnp:albumArtURI dlna:profileID="JPEG_TN">http://192.168.1.15:9000/disk/defaultalbumart/nocover_video.jpg/O0$3$28I2315.jpg?scale=160x160</upnp:albumArtURI>
    <pv:extension>VOB</pv:extension>
    <pv:lastPlayedTime>2011-09-21T15:31:10</pv:lastPlayedTime>
    <pv:playcount>12</pv:playcount>
    <pv:modificationTime>1316534256</pv:modificationTime>
    <pv:addedTime>1316588594</pv:addedTime>
    <pv:lastUpdated>1316534256</pv:lastUpdated>
    <res duration="0:00:02.882" size="974848" resolution="720x576"
     dlna:ifoFileURI="http://192.168.1.15:9000/disk/O0$3$32$46$47R2315.ifo"
     protocolInfo="http-get:*:video/mpeg:DLNA.ORG_PN=MPEG_PS_PAL;DLNA.ORG_OP=11;DLNA.ORG_FLAGS=01700000000000000000000000000000"
     pv:timeseekinfo="http://192.168.1.15:9000/disk/O0$3$32$46$47R2315.seek">http://192.168.1.15:9000/disk/DLNA-PNMPEG_PS_PAL-OP11-FLAGS01700000/O0$3$28I2315.VOB</res>
    <upnp:class>object.item.videoItem.movie</upnp:class>
    </item>

object.container.storageFolder:
    <container id="0$3$35" parentID="0$3" restricted="0" childCount="1" searchable="1">
    <dc:title>By Folder</dc:title>
    <pv:modificationTime>0</pv:modificationTime>
    <upnp:class>object.container.storageFolder</upnp:class>
    </container>

So, would it be possible to implement chaptering for Samsung TVs?
Samsung's AllShare generates .mta files which are XMLs with five chapters and JPEG screenshots encoded in base64, and then offers them as
<sec:MetaFileInfo sec:type="mta">http://192.168.0.4:17679/FileProvider/108</sec:MetaFileInfo>
in directory listings and item info petitions. The TV requests the resource later if needed.
You have all the info about the file spec here:
http://forum.conceiva.com/showthread.ph ... -series-TV
http://forum.conceiva.com/showthread.ph ... amsung-TVs
I have made a Wireshark capture switching on the TV, browsing a folder, starting a video, and then going to a chapter with AllShare, and attached the data sent within each TCP stream as text, hope it helps.
It would be great to have support for these .mta files. Even if Serviio doesn't generate them, we could start AllShare and have it generate them, or even another tool could be written for that.
Please, consider it. A lot of people have Samsung TVs where FF/RW don't work.

I was thinking about this before. I would be easy to implement but there is one thing to consider: CPU and indexing speed. If we have to generate 6 thumbnails for each video instead of 1 many people would not be happy. It could be a turn off/on feature but then a lot of people would miss on it. I wonder it it works without the images.
